This is a list of famous and widely used applications and software packages written in C or C++ programming languages. Applications written in both C and C++ programming languages are included due to the fact that most of the applications are partially or completely written in either C language or C++.
These applications are mainly, but not limited to, operating systems, new programming languages, Graphical User Interfaces (GUI) and Integrated Development (IDE) are written in C/C++. The operating systems include Windows 95, 98, 2000, XP, Apple OS X, Symbian OS and BeOS.
